Transaction 178991edd4931147e62d812127bcf664ced6f2af9f1220950538479133bc5b83
1 Input
1 Output
-
178991edd4931147e62d812127bcf664ced6f2af9f1220950538479133bc5b83:0
- value
- 40907009
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b0c93351b2ee9afe441e39beeb467b209331c54
- address
- bc1qrvxfxdgm9m56lezpuwd7adr8kgynx8z5a9352j